Test Foro de elhacker.net SMF 2.1

Programación => Desarrollo Web => PHP => Mensaje iniciado por: Shell Root en 4 Febrero 2011, 04:20 AM

Título: Enviar mensaje de texto desde PHP
Publicado por: Shell Root en 4 Febrero 2011, 04:20 AM
Bueh, por ahora ando en un proyecto y tengo una pregunta -nunca he trabajo con un sistema así-, y como adicción a una aplicación, tengo que informarme al personal de trabajo de la aplicación mediante un mensaje de texto.

A la hora de enviar un mensaje de texto, supongo que se debería de pagar por ese servicio? O quizás con el plan de empresa -para celulares-, se pueda emplear de alguna u otra forma?

Alguien podría orientarme?
Título: Re: Enviar mensaje de texto desde PHP
Publicado por: Castg! en 4 Febrero 2011, 07:08 AM
Mirá, la verdad nunca lo usé, probé ni nada por el estilo, pero deduzco que si hay muchisimas páginas de "SMS gratis a cualquier celular", si es que esta no la ofrece, sería muy fácil hacer una API, reemplazando el form original de la página por un script PHP.
Sin embargo, en la pagina web PHPClasses (http://www.phpclasses.org/search.html?words=sms&x=10&y=1&go_search=1) se pueden encontrar muchas clases interesantes que se pueden investigar (lógicamente usan un servidor externo, a menos que tu servidor use un sistema 3G jeje).
A ver que conseguís.
Nos vimos!
Título: Re: Enviar mensaje de texto desde PHP
Publicado por: Servia en 4 Febrero 2011, 15:09 PM
Aquí hay un script open source de envío de sms:
https://github.com/qoobaa/sms

A ver si te sirve revisar su código. Teóricamente soporta 2 gateways de envío de sms.
Título: Re: Enviar mensaje de texto desde PHP
Publicado por: Nakp en 4 Febrero 2011, 16:39 PM
pues en el caso de mi pais :P se envian a un correo electronico del tipo numero@compañia.com.sv xD necesitas una api la cual las operadoras solo proveen si sueltas $$$ :/ tambien hay una app en RoR (creo) que permite enviar mensajes pero cuestan 0.01 per sms x_x
Título: Re: Enviar mensaje de texto desde PHP
Publicado por: Castg! en 4 Febrero 2011, 18:55 PM
En mi país también se puede enviar sms vía email. Lógicamente uno debe tener activado en su línea la recepción de estos. Podes hacer como te dije de crear vos una API utilizando un servidor externo que tenga una "Detección automática de empresa" y asi te ahorrarías bastantes problemas.
Por si te interesa, hace un tiempo estuve investigando el "SMS Spoofing", lo cual no tuve resultado, jajaja. Pero por si queres ver algo yo encontre estas dos páginas las cuales vos le agregas el N° de Remietnte o un simple Nombre de identificador (para enviar mensajes del tipo:
CitarDe: Shell-root
Mensaje: Debes ingresar este codigo
para activar tu cuenta.

Entonces asi, el usuario sabe que lo enviaste vos sin tener que tener un N° registrado en la agenda de contactos).

http://www.sendanonymoussms.com/ (http://www.sendanonymoussms.com/)
http://www.smsanonimo.com/ (http://www.smsanonimo.com/)

Acordate de qu al momento que el usuario registra su teléfono, lo escriba correctamente:
Citar+(codigo país)(código de área)(numerodecelular)
Título: Re: Enviar mensaje de texto desde PHP
Publicado por: Shell Root en 4 Febrero 2011, 19:11 PM
Pues @Castg!, acabo de hacer pruebas con las 2 paginas que me dejaste y no me funcionaron...

Pero una pregunta, a ver... Lo que dijo @Pwnr, es que puedo enviar un SMS, como si fuera un e-mail? Sólo si tiene un servicio activado?
Título: Re: Enviar mensaje de texto desde PHP
Publicado por: Castg! en 4 Febrero 2011, 20:35 PM
Si, y es así como funcionan las páginas para enviar mensajes de texto a cualquier empresa, lo que tienen de bueno estas, es que a veces te lo detectan automáticamente...
Título: Re: Enviar mensaje de texto desde PHP
Publicado por: Shell Root en 7 Febrero 2011, 18:39 PM
Por ahora, espero usar el servicio que dijo @Pwnr, podrías decirme como se llama ese servicio?, para averiguarlo en entidades como, movistar, comcel u otros....